Johnny White runs to head of backfield
Posted Sep 11, 2007
Redshirt freshman Johnny White has emerged at the top of North Carolina's crowded tailback rotation. Coach Butch Davis said Monday there has been "a little, tiny bit" of separation at tailback for the Tar Heels, who had been listing White, Anthony Elzy and Richie Rich as starters. White carried nine times for 43 yards and caught four passes for 58 yards during Saturday's 34-31 loss at East Carolina.
